Since this is a duet, it’s essential that you read the books in order – this picks up right where the last one left off. Things are definitely in a precarious position for our couple – Viola and Jasper are two people who are clearly meant to be together, but their history means there are countless obstacles in their path. If it’s not Jasper’s brother getting in their way, it’s the rock star lifestyle or the attention from the media. Where the first book focused on how Viola was breaking Jasper’s heart by being his brother’s girl, this one focuses on how Jasper is breaking Viola’s heart because he can’t see that she’s his. The rest, well, you’ll have to find that out for yourself.
